Let me say this one more time. The only tranny that will work wil be one from a 90-93 teg or if you can find a b16 cable one.

Thats it, no other cobination of changing bell housings or anything like that is going to work. (Unless you want to do a hydro to cable conversion but if your just going to sell the car, thats a waste of money.)

To clearify...

You need a trans from a 90-93 Integra RS/LS/GS/GSR...

Any other B Series transmission is not worth your time or money to swap in, becuase they are not direct replacements.

NO the trans the junkyard is trying to sell you will not FIT. It's from a Civic... you need on from a 90-93 Integra.
